Sirenova’s installation is intentionally straightforward: mount the included rear plate, insert the two AA batteries included with the package, press and hold the test button until the device’s LED begins to flash, then follow the in-app steps to connect to your Wi‑Fi. Sirenova is engineered to be used daily and to provide 24/7 monitoring without professional installation, and Sirenova’s small footprint and light weight make it a flexible choice for apartments, single-family homes, or rental properties where tenants may not be able to alter electrical wiring. Sirenova also addresses common smart product concerns: the low battery warning is built in (a beep every 55 seconds with a flashing red LED), and Sirenova’s support materials walk users through battery replacement and testing so that the Sirenova device stays reliable over the long term.

Sirenova requires a 2.4GHz Wi‑Fi network to connect for remote alerts, and Sirenova also asks you to enable Bluetooth during initial pairing to help the app discover and add the device; once Sirenova is connected to Wi‑Fi through the app, notifications are pushed to your smartphone the instant the detector senses smoke. Sirenova’s on-device test button also makes it easy to check functionality periodically; pressing the test button produces an audible alarm so you can confirm Sirenova’s siren and sensing system are operational. Because Sirenova is a photoelectric detector, it tends to be particularly effective at sensing smoldering fires that emit smoke early in the combustion process, and Sirenova’s phone alerts allow you to make decisions—call a neighbor, ring a property manager, or dial emergency services—before a small smolder turns into a larger blaze.
